Unlocking Hidden Trends with Technical Indicators

Technical indicators are powerful tools for traders seeking to identify hidden trends across financial markets. These mathematical formulas interpret price and volume data to produce signals that indicate potential buying opportunities. By employing a variety of technical indicators, traders can gain valuable insights into market direction.

  • Moving averages filter price fluctuations, revealing underlying trends.
  • Relative strength index (RSI) measure momentum, signaling potential overbought or oversold conditions.
  • Trendlines indicate areas of potential reversal.

By utilizing multiple technical indicators, traders can create a more complete view of market dynamics, ultimately leading to more informed trading decisions.

Unveiling Fibonacci Retracements in Forex Trading

Fibonacci retracement levels are a popular technique used by forex traders to identify potential resistance points within market fluctuations. These levels are derived from the Fibonacci sequence, a mathematical sequence where each number is the sum of the check here two preceding ones.

Leveraging these retracement levels, traders can visualize potential reversals in price trends. Fibonacci retracement levels are often used in conjunction with other technical indicators to validate trading entries.

A common practice is to insert Fibonacci retracement lines on a chart, connecting the peaks and troughs of a recent price trend. The resulting levels are typically expressed as percentages: 23.6%, 38.2%, 50%, 61.8%, and 100%. Traders often look for price action to bounce off these retracement levels, suggesting a potential shift in the existing trend direction.

However, it's crucial to remember that Fibonacci retracements are not foolproof. They should be used as a part of a broader trading system and integrated with other technical and fundamental analysis.
